If you are looking to add a new dog to your family, and would be open to a friendly older guy that loves playing with other calm dogs, Jake may be your guy!! Jake is 9 1/2 years old, and found himself homeless after his loving owner passed away, and this left Jake and a female pitbull alone in the home for a week to fend for themselves. Jake has adjusted well in foster care but he originally did have anxiety when left alone. He will need a family that will be patient with him for a bit while he learns the routine of a new home. He still loves being very close to his foster mom or dad. He does fabulous with other calm dogs, is playful, and wrestles with his friend dog. Jake listens well, and is the typical intelligent GSD. We would like Jake to go to a home with a fenced yard but owner will need to walk him on a leash in that fence until he feels bonded. Jake has met children and was friendly to them.
